Defining relative clauses: example : Sherlock who is smoking doesn’t wear a hat., no comma before the relative pronoun/adverb, the clause provides ESSENTIAL information, the clause cannot be removed, no pauses in speaking, Non-defining relative clauses: example : Sherlock, who doesn’t wear a hat, is smoking., comma before the relative pronoun/adverb, the clause provides EXTRA information, the clause can be removed without affecting the whole sentence, pauses in speaking,

Defining vs non-defining relative clauses - lesson
